28 #include "config.h"
29
30 #include <errno.h>
31 #include <inttypes.h>
32 #include <limits.h>
33 #include <stddef.h>
34 #include <stdint.h>
35 #include <stdlib.h>
36 #include <string.h>
37 #include <stdio.h>
38
39 #include "dav1d_fuzzer.h"
40
41 // expects ivf input
42
main(int argc,char * argv[])43 int main(int argc, char *argv[]) {
44 int ret = -1;
45 FILE *f = NULL;
46 int64_t fsize;
47 const char *filename = NULL;
48 uint8_t *data = NULL;
49 size_t size = 0;
50
51 if (LLVMFuzzerInitialize(&argc, &argv)) {
52 return 1;
53 }
54
55 if (argc != 2) {
56 fprintf(stdout, "Usage:\n%s fuzzing_testcase.ivf\n", argv[0]);
57 return -1;
58 }
59 filename = argv[1];
60
61 if (!(f = fopen(filename, "rb"))) {
62 fprintf(stderr, "failed to open %s: %s\n", filename, strerror(errno));
63 goto error;
64 }
65
66 if (fseeko(f, 0, SEEK_END) == -1) {
67 fprintf(stderr, "fseek(%s, 0, SEEK_END) failed: %s\n", filename,
68 strerror(errno));
69 goto error;
70 }
71 if ((fsize = ftello(f)) == -1) {
72 fprintf(stderr, "ftell(%s) failed: %s\n", filename, strerror(errno));
73 goto error;
74 }
75 rewind(f);
76
77 if (fsize < 0 || fsize > INT_MAX) {
78 fprintf(stderr, "%s is too large: %"PRId64"\n", filename, fsize);
79 goto error;
80 }
81 size = (size_t)fsize;
82
83 if (!(data = malloc(size))) {
84 fprintf(stderr, "failed to allocate: %zu bytes\n", size);
85 goto error;
86 }
87
88 if (fread(data, size, 1, f) == size) {
89 fprintf(stderr, "failed to read %zu bytes from %s: %s\n", size,
90 filename, strerror(errno));
91 goto error;
92 }
93
94 ret = LLVMFuzzerTestOneInput(data, size);
95
96 error:
97 free(data);
98 if (f) fclose(f);
99 return ret;
100 }
